Output e81f6f5723aa303878fc72afbb28c642ba41f172c616ccaa14eded003f41b51e:2

value
7114909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f6738ae13ab8c1a5b967f68be0eba0a52c81c2f OP_EQUAL
address
3EmGCvaQPoosrpCvRixqZ5gNFA2G2Yz46G
transaction
e81f6f5723aa303878fc72afbb28c642ba41f172c616ccaa14eded003f41b51e
spent
true